What is Standard Atmosphere to Decipascal Conversion?
Standard Atmosphere (atm) and decipascal (dPa) are both units used to measure pressure, but they serve different purposes depending on the scale of the measurement. If you ever need to convert standard atmosphere to decipascal, knowing the exact conversion formula is essential.
Atm to dpa Conversion Formula:
One Standard Atmosphere is equal to 1013250 Decipascal.
Formula: 1 atm = 1013250 dPa
By using this conversion factor, you can easily convert any pressure from standard atmosphere to decipascal with precision.
